Output 50c81d975ec20d550a8437c17b490de6787f6e5968ed34f543fc4984bfe28a18:5

value
785050692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b34828409dda6d99a512f0fa060f754fc5ef835 OP_EQUAL
address
38YfWNs9p1hqK1nW6j5zjVmsYywWcRxrgR
transaction
50c81d975ec20d550a8437c17b490de6787f6e5968ed34f543fc4984bfe28a18
spent
true